Building and Ambiance

The majority of reviewers have commented favourably on the building, describing it as a "lovely" place with a "clean" and "nice" atmosphere. Author Jane Kenny noted that it is suitable for wedding receptions, while Author Stuart Mcgrath mentioned that it has a good selection of spirits and beers at the bar.

Service

However, several reviewers were disappointed with the service they received. Author Loki was particularly unimpressed with the lunch service, describing it as chaotic, slow, amateurish, and disorganised. Author Allan James also expressed disappointment with the service at the dining table, stating that they were left without potatoes for 15 minutes while the dinner went cold.

Food and Drink

The food at the venue has received mixed reviews. Author Stuart Mcgrath described the food as "awesome", while Author Joe Crabtree praised the food as "absolutely fantastic". On the other hand, Author Loki was disappointed with the tasteless lunch they received.
